Norway - Hard Coal Mining Turnover Per Employee
Since 2014, Norway Hard Coal Mining Turnover Per Employee was down by 21.8% year on year. In 2019, the country was ranked number 3 comparing other countries in Hard Coal Mining Turnover Per Employee with €99.5 Thousand. Norway is overtaken by United Kingdom, which was number 2 at €174.2 Thousand and is followed by Spain with €95.1 Thousand. Bulgaria recorded the best 5 years average growth at +71.7% per year, while Norway recorded the worst performance at -21.8% per year.
